Research On Constant Voltage Output Characteristics Of Hybrid Excitation Generator Utilizing Tooth Harmonic For Excitation

Under the circumstance of brushless,no exciter and no voltage regulator,to realizes the constant output of the terminal voltage.It has important application prospects and practical value of the hybrid excitation generator utilizing tooth harmonic for excitation.This paper studies around the automatic matching of load and excitation of the hybrid excitation generator utilizing tooth harmonic for excitation,and realizes the constant voltage output of the generator through the methods of design.The development history and research status of hybrid excitation synchronous generator and harmonic excitation generator is introduced.Aiming at the operation efficiency,reliability,air-gap magnetic field regulation ability of the generator,etc.The comparison and analysis of general the permanent magnet synchronous generator,the hybrid excitation synchronous generator and the tooth harmonic excitation excitation synchronous generator are carried out in detail.The basic principle of automatic constant voltage output for kinds of harmonic excitation synchronous generator is analyzed,and the essential difference of constant output is realized.Aiming at the hybrid excitation generator utilizing tooth harmonic for excitation,presents a realization of the compound characteristic based on the deviation of load air gap magnetic field.A finite element model of the machine is established based on this method,and the simulation verifies the feasibility of this method.This paper presents a method to determine the harmonic coil turns to realize the compound characteristic of the generator,which is convert the tooth harmonic exciting circuit into the DC circuit model,and then construct the equations of the tooth harmonic winding turns.Then solve the equations to determine the number of turns.Based on this method,a tooth harmonic excitation generator is developed,simulation and experiment were carried out.The results show that for the resistive load,the generator has a good constant voltage output characteristic within a certain load range.
